Paul Nash passed away Tuesday, January 25, 2022 from pneumonia at St Peter’s Hospital in Helena.
Paul was born June 24, 1942 to Jessie and William Nash in Shelby, Montana. He grew up in Devon, Montana and at Lakeside in the Flathead Valley. His sister, Viola has fond memories of Paul as a young child of 4 or 5 playing with their little white dog in the small creek near their house. They would play tug of war right in the creek and Paul would get quite upset if the dog won. Then, there was the day that he crawled up on the table grabbed the bowl full of butter and put it on top of his head. Mother was not happy!
After completing his schooling Paul worked on farms and ranches in the Sweet Grass Hills in Toole County, near White Sulphur Springs and near Townsend. Paul became disabled after a farm accident that damaged his vision about 1990. He then moved to Helena to be near his sister Emma.
Paul was a long-time resident of the Serendipity Apartments (now the Firetower Apartments). He could often be found sitting on the bench in front of the apartments people watching, visiting with friends, and enjoying the sun. Paul often attended Alive at Five concerts and helped friends set up their booth at the Farmers Market on Saturdays. Paul was able to get to most of his destinations by walking and frequently walked to Vans for groceries and enjoyed breakfast and meeting friends at Hardee’s. The Walking Mall was a favorite destination also. Later when his health began to fail, the Park Avenue Bakery became his place for morning coffee and a roll.
Paul loved to reminisce about growing up with his siblings, hunting, fishing and camping in the Flathead Valley. Some of his favorite memories were about working on ranches in the Sweet Grass Hills.
Paul was preceded in death by his parents, brothers Leo, Edward, Frank, Virgil and Dan; sisters Emma, Verda, and Neva; niece Christine; and great-nephew Evan.
Paul is survived by his sister Viola and numerous nieces and nephews.
